What are the most popular songs for Indie Pop musician Fox Glove?

With their fascinating melodies, Fox Glove, an indie pop band from Victoria, Canada, has grown in popularity. Their best songs include "Push Too Hard," "Birds," "Where R U Now," "Does This Scare You Yet?," "Seasons," "The Water Will Be Your Home," "Jessie," "Breath in the Wind," "Universe, Be Damned," and "Home for the Holidays."

Which are the most important collaborations with other musicians for Indie Pop musician Fox Glove?

The Canadian pop and indie pop musician Fox Glove, from Victoria, has worked with a number of well-known musicians. A song from one of these collaborations is "Push Too Hard" by Astrocolor. A hypnotic and dynamic composition is produced as a result of this combination between Fox Glove's captivating vocals and Astrocolor's electronic and atmospheric soundscapes. The song "Birds" with Astrocolor is another noteworthy collaboration. A really compelling musical experience is produced in this song by the flawless blending of Fox Glove's expressive and haunting vocals with Astrocolor's sophisticated production.

Additionally, C:Real and Fox Glove worked together on the song "Where R U Now" In this collaboration, Fox Glove demonstrates her versatility by blending her sound with C:Real's pop-infused sound and giving an intense and contagious performance.
